2007 Men's Lacrosse Overview
Men’s Lacrosse
is under new management this season with the hire of Nate
Watkins, former University of Maryland All-American and
current Major League Lacrosse star. The Poets return a solid
group of players from the 2006 team that finished the year 7-7.
They are led by captains Dave Gerbarg (team-high 22 goals
in ’06), Mike Prickett (team-high 14 assists in ’06) and
Dan Aas who returns after being abroad last season to
anchor the Poet defense. Whittier burst onto the collegiate
lacrosse scene in 2003, making it to the NCAA Tournament
semifinals, the best finish in school history. A year later,
they went back to the tournament and were knocked out in the
second round. Watkins isn’t accepting another 7-7 finish in
2007. “This year our goal is to bring Whittier College lacrosse
back to the NCAA tournament and competing for a National
Championship.” The Poets begin their season on February 10 at
Notre Dame De Namur. |

Men's Lacrosse Drops a Pair in Ohio
Lackey '09 Tallies Eight Points in Two Games
Anthony Lackey '09 had four goals and four assists,
but Whittier College lost two games on their spring break trip
in Ohio on April 1 and 3. The Poets (3-7) lost their first
game of the trip 13-6 at the College of Wooster
on April 1, and then lost 13-11 to Ohio Wesleyan University
